Bolton to Birkenhead Park by train

A train trip from Bolton to Birkenhead Park takes about 1hrs 58 mins on average, covering roughly 28 miles (45 kilometres). With around 67 trains running each day, there's plenty of flexibility for your travel plans. If you book in advance, you can grab tickets starting from just £16.60, making it a budget-friendly option for those who plan ahead.

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Bolton to Birkenhead Park start from £23.10 one way, or £16.70 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Bolton to Birkenhead Park are available for £16.60 one way, or £20.10 return

Facilities and Amenities

Bolton train station is well-equipped to cater to any traveler's needs. With a ticket office operating from 06:00 to 21:00 on weekdays and slightly reduced hours on Sundays, obtaining and collecting tickets is straightforward. Numerous ticket machines are available for those who prefer a swift, automated service, and these cater to both cash and card transactions. The station champions accessibility, ensuring step-free access throughout the premises, including lifts to all platforms, which makes it a Category A station.

For those needing assistance, Bolton station offers staff-support options, although customer help points are absent. Amenities at the station include clean, accessible toilets, baby changing facilities, and cozy waiting rooms—between platforms for your comfort while awaiting departure. CCTV ensures a safe environment as you explore the variety of refreshment facilities and the newsagent available on-site.

Facilities and Amenities at Birkenhead Park

Birkenhead Park Station is well-equipped to cater to the needs of travelers. The ticket office is open throughout the week, with staffing available from 05:51 to 00:15 on weekdays and differing times on weekends, ensuring you can get your tickets with ease. For those looking to collect pre-purchased tickets, this station offers convenient collection from the ticket office.

Though the station lacks ticket machines and accessible ticketing equipment, it compensates with step-free access throughout, making it a Category A station. This means that all passengers, including those with reduced mobility, can move around easily. In addition to these, the presence of an induction loop and ramps for train access further enhances its accessibility features.

Travelers wishing for some downtime can find a seating area, though waiting rooms are not featured. If you're looking to grab a quick read or snack, head to the on-site newsagent. While there are no dedicated refreshment facilities, travelers will appreciate the convenience of having this basic but essential shopping service.

Transport Links and Connections

Alongside its excellent rail services, Birkenhead Park Station offers various transport links to ensure that your onward journey is smooth and hassle-free. While there's no taxi rank on-site, the nearby bus services at Duke Street provide a reliable alternative. For additional travel information, Merseytravel offers comprehensive advice on their website.

If you're planning to fly out, the station offers a convenient link to Liverpool John Lennon Airport. Purchasing a ticket to 'Liverpool John Lennon Airport' at any Merseyrail station includes a seamless journey to the airport on buses 86A or 80A from Liverpool South Parkway, taking just ten minutes.
